BJP and NDA Lost In Nearly Half The Seats Where PM Narendra Modi Held Rallies
PM Modi had given speeches in 164 constituencies, among which the BJP lost 77 seats.
By: FATIMA KHAN
BJP or NDA candidates lost in nearly half the seats where PM Narendra Modi gave speeches as part of the campaign in the run-up to the 2024 Lok Sabha elections. The Quint analysed the 164 constituencies where PM Modi held public meetings and gave speeches, and found that the BJP/NDA candidate lost in 77 of the seats, and won on 87. This includes only the speeches delivered by PM Modi between 16 March (when the Model Code of Conduct came into force) till 30 May which was the last day of campaigning in the elections. The list of speeches were procured from PM Modi’s official website. This does not include roadshows.
